Description
Forensic experts explain scientific principles to solve crimes- Learn to analyse prints, knots, fibres, soil, blood, gold, etc. in 13 chapters- Filled with colourful illustrations, fun activities and Singapore cases- Language is simple and easy to understand for teen readers.

Description
What is forensic science and how is it used to solve a crime? How do you know if a red stain is blood or ketchup, or whose blood it is? Can computers really recognize your face in a crowd? How do scientists decide how old bones are, and trace who they once belonged to? Explore the fascinating, and sometimes gory, world of forensics, where science helps crack the case.
